This tutorial explains how you can manage the artwork approval process for your campaign on CAASie:
Two-Stage Approval: When you upload artwork, it first goes through a pre-approval by CAASie’s team. After that, it’s sent to media owners for final approval.
Approval Timeline: CAASie typically pre-approves artworks within 48 hours. Media owners can take up to 7 days to perform the final approval of the artwork, depending on the country. In some cases this can be even longer.
Tracking Approval Status: On your campaign dashboard, you can navigate to the artwork section to check the approval status. Hovering over the status icon will reveal whether your artwork is approved or still pending.
Handling Rejections: If your artwork is rejected, you can contact the CAASie team via live chat or email. They’ll help you understand the issue and guide you in making the necessary adjustments.
This process ensures your artwork meets both CAASie’s and media owners’ standards before going live.
